Built for high-performance applications
The absolute multi-DoF encoder system from Renishaw is ideally suited to high-performance motion systems. Highly dynamic applications such as XY stages used by the semiconductor industry require exceptional accuracy and repeatability to meet quality and productivity demands. By measuring multiple degrees of freedom along each axis, machine builders can dynamically measure error sources such as the straightness of linear guideways. Renishaw multi-DoF encoders enable in-process compensation of the resulting translation and rotation errors, helping to maintain process capability and improve component yields.


True X and Y axis measurement
RXMA30 scales feature two orthogonal scale patterns, enabling direct position measurement in the X and Y axes. Independently measuring the primary linear degrees of freedom can provide some metrology benefits. For example, measurements in the Y axis are immune to any thermal expansion detected in the typically longer X axis.
Easy electrical and mechanical integration
Renishaw's multi-DoF approach combines distinct, separate axes to enable easier integration with the control loop. Direct measurement of the X and Y axes enables convenient signal processing and compatibility with a range of serial interfaces.
Machine designers can position readheads to suit the requirements of the application, as individual readheads act independently of each other. A combination of end-exit and side-exit cables can also be configured, helping to simplify cable routing for each axis.

Absolute multi-DoF encoder systems: readheads and scales
Multi-DoF encoder systems consist of at least one 1.5D scale and two or more readheads. The maximum scale length for the absolute readhead and scale is shown below:
RESOLUTE™ readhead (30 µm pitch) High accuracy High speed |
RXM Multi-DoF scale 1.5D glass spar scale Low expansion High repeatability X axis = 350 mm Y axis = 4 mm |
